[0031]The invention relates to a method for controlling a power train of an electric or hybrid vehicle 20 immobilized in a parking position. In an electric or hybrid vehicle 20, the power train, which is designated in French by the acronym GMP, comprises, as represented schematically in FIG. 1, at least one electric motor 1, a reduction gear mechanism 3, motor mounts 4, 4′, a device for controlling the power train and a battery 7 intended to supply the electric motor 1. The latter generates a motor torque which is transmitted to the wheels 2, 2′ (two wheels are represented in FIG. 1) by means of the gear reduction mechanism 3 in order to drive the vehicle 20.

A method controls a power train of a vehicle immobilized in a parking position, the vehicle being provided with a parking brake device for immobilizing the vehicle and at least one electric motor. The method includes detecting the slope direction and / or slope data when the parking brake device is in an actuated position, detecting that the parking brake device has switched from the actuated position to a released position, and applying a motor torque setpoint to the electric motor in accordance with the detected slope direction and / or slope data.

1. F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]The invention relates to the field of motor vehicles, in particular any electric or hybrid vehicle equipped with at least one electric motor. The invention relates to a method for controlling a power train of a vehicle when the vehicle is immobilized on a surface exhibiting a slope of any kind. It also relates to a device as well as to the corresponding vehicle.2. PRIOR ART[0002]In an electric or hybrid vehicle, at least one electric motor generates a motor torque which is transmitted to the wheels by means of a reduction gear mechanism in order to drive the vehicle. The electric motor is connected to the vehicle by means of mounts making it possible to limit the propagation of the vibrations generated by the electric motor.
